So, 'Welcome to Pia Carrot!! The Movie: Sayaka's Love Story' is an interesting watch for anyone into quirky anime. It has this light-hearted vibe that’s mixed with some genuine warmth. You have Yusuke Kinoshita, who’s kind of thrown into a summer job at his dad’s restaurant because of his lack of school enthusiasm. There’s a nice blend of comedy and romantic tension that develops through his interactions with the eclectic staff. The animation isn’t groundbreaking, but it captures the overall blissful chaos of working in a bustling eatery. The pacing feels right; it keeps you engaged without overstaying its welcome. The character dynamics and light romantic undertones make it distinctive, certainly a slice-of-life charm that feels personal yet relatable.
